I wanted to watch some videos about FreeBSD, so I went to Youtube and searched on "FreeBSD". Then I sorted by "Date Uploaded", and almost all the videos uploaded recently are about hacking MSN. I went to the people's profiles, and they had no videos available. I am guessing that people are creating fake YT accounts to post a video that then gets removed by YT. It makes it impossible to find recent YT videos about FreeBSD. I just wondering if anyone else noticed this. If you do the basic YT search sorted on "Relevance", you get really old FreeBSD videos. SOLVED: I just noticed you can filter out "msn" from your results by searching for "freebsd -msn".
